John Deere 5325N Tractor Parts
5325N parts and accessories
The John Deere 5325N, manufactured from 2004 to 2007, is a narrow row crop tractor renowned for its versatility and maneuverability. Powered by a reliable 74 HP John Deere PowerTech diesel engine, it delivers a practical 62 PTO horsepower. Its compact design and robust build made it a popular choice for farmers needing a powerful machine in tight spaces, especially for specialty crops.
The John Deere 5325N was part of the 5000N series, designed for narrow row applications where a standard-width tractor would be impractical. Production spanned from 2004 to 2007. Under the hood sits a John Deere PowerTech 3029T 3-cylinder diesel engine, producing approximately 74 engine horsepower. This engine has a displacement of 179 cubic inches (2.9 liters). The 5325N offered a variety of transmission options, including a 9-speed gear transmission with synchronized shuttle and a 12-speed PowrReverser transmission for enhanced directional changes. It features an independent 540 RPM PTO delivering around 62 PTO horsepower. The hydraulic system provides a flow rate of approximately 12.7 GPM, supporting two rear remotes. The 3-point hitch is a Category II with a lift capacity of approximately 2600 lbs, making it suitable for a range of implements. Common applications include row crop farming, orchard and vineyard work, and general utility tasks. What sets the 5325N apart is its narrow configuration, allowing it to navigate tight rows without damaging crops, while still offering the power and features of a larger tractor.
Specifications
| Engine | John Deere PowerTech 74 HP Diesel |
|---|---|
| PTO HP | 62 HP @ 540 RPM |
| Transmission | 9-Speed Gear or 12-Speed PowrReverser |
| Hydraulics | 12.7 GPM, 2 remotes |
| 3-Point Hitch | Category II, 2600 lbs |
| Fuel Capacity | 19.3 gallons |
| Weight | 5622 lbs |
| Years Produced | 2004-2007 |
Maintenance Tips
- Engine Oil and Filter: Change the engine oil and filter every 250 hours using the recommended John Deere oil type and filter. Regularly check the oil level and top off as needed.
- Hydraulic System: Inspect the hydraulic fluid level and condition regularly. Change the hydraulic fluid and filter every 500 hours or annually to prevent contamination and ensure proper operation of hydraulic components.
- Fuel System: Use clean, high-quality diesel fuel. Replace the fuel filter every 250 hours to prevent clogging and maintain optimal engine performance.
- Seasonal Storage: Before storing the tractor for the winter, drain the fuel tank and fuel lines to prevent fuel degradation. Add a fuel stabilizer if you choose to store with fuel. Disconnect the battery and store it in a cool, dry place. Grease all lubrication points.
History & Background
Introduced in 2004, the John Deere 5325N filled a need for a narrow tractor with substantial power and capabilities. It was part of John Deere's effort to provide specialized solutions for various agricultural applications. While not subject to major redesigns during its short production run, it remains a popular choice for farmers seeking a reliable and maneuverable narrow tractor.
Frequently Asked Questions
What engine is in the John Deere 5325N?
The John Deere 5325N is equipped with a John Deere PowerTech 3029T 3-cylinder diesel engine producing 74 horsepower with a displacement of 179 cubic inches (2.9 liters).
What is the PTO horsepower on a 5325N?
The John Deere 5325N has a PTO horsepower rating of 62 HP at 540 RPM.
What oil filter fits the 5325N?
The recommended oil filter for the John Deere 5325N is a John Deere M806418 or a compatible cross-reference such as a Wix 51348 or a Baldwin B1421.
What are common parts needed for the 5325N?
Common parts needed for the John Deere 5325N include engine oil filters, fuel filters, air filters, hydraulic filters, belts (alternator/fan belt), hydraulic seals for cylinders and remotes, steering components (tie rod ends, ball joints), and clutch parts (pressure plate, disc, release bearing) if equipped with a manual transmission.
